stefan khacheturian recording, the drum on the far left is a 1930 premier dominion super, the first snare drum stef ever bought, this is the very very rare brass snare, it was the snare drum from stefs first drum kit bought in early 1973,stefs first kit was a 1960s hoshino gakki in red sparkle,bought from a second hand shop at the bottom of chappeltown road in leeds england for the massive sum of 25 quid ,the kit you see is the 1978 tama superstar, with 18'' and 12'' remo roto toms, the main kit snare is the premier 35,[1973] cymbals, paiste 2002 heavy ride 20'', 2002 11'' splash,
and the one and only paiste 2002 sound edge hihats14'',,
